Concerning the menu, I didn't want to tell this but since you've 
mentioned it, in Mandriva, the menu is not really a KDE one, it's a 
layer above that make it dynamic. eg. if I install kopete only as a chat 
client, it will be under Internet->Kopete. If I add Gaim, the menu will 
change and kopete and gaim will be under Internet->Chat->Kopete and 
Internet->Chat->Gaim. That layer is called MenuDrake. My point in 
telling you this is the place of the sotware in the menu do not depend 
entirely on the packager (as you said). But in Kubuntu, it always does.
